Brass Scrap Market in Murliganj

In Murliganj, the supply of brass scrap is predominantly sourced from domestic consumption and localized artisanal activities rather than large industrial outflows. The primary sources include discarded utensils from households, decommissioned religious idols and fittings from local temples, and scrap generated by small plumbing and electrical workshops operating within the town's central market areas. Demand is driven by local artisans who repurpose the metal for smaller fabrication jobs, alongside scrap aggregators who collect it for resale. These collected materials are typically traded through established local scrap yards near the main thoroughfares, which act as collection points before the material is transported to larger metal markets in nearby district headquarters for bulk processing and pricing in ₹ per kg. The quality of the scrap often varies, requiring careful sorting based on the alloy composition.

Selling Brass Scrap in Murliganj, Bihar?

Brass is a copper-zinc alloy valued for its high copper content, making it one of the more premium non-ferrous scraps in Murliganj. Common sources include old plumbing fixtures, valves, door hardware, keys, musical instruments, bullet casings, and decorative items. Yellow brass (70% copper, 30% zinc) is the most common grade, while red brass (85% copper, 15% zinc) commands higher prices. Brass scrap is always in demand from foundries that recast it into new fittings and components.

Pro Tip for Brass Sellers in Murliganj:

Verify your brass with a magnet — genuine brass is completely non-magnetic. Brass-plated steel (which is magnetic) is worth only steel prices. Red brass (reddish hue, heavier) pays 15-25% more than yellow brass. Clean brass free of steel screws, rubber gaskets, and plastic handles to avoid deductions at the dealer.

Understanding Brass Scrap Rates in Murliganj

The Brass scrap market in Murliganj, Bihar is shaped by a combination of global commodity trends and local economic factors. International benchmarks like the LME (London Metal Exchange) and domestic platforms like MCX (Multi Commodity Exchange of India) set the baseline for Brass pricing. However, the actual rate you receive from a dealer in Murliganj also depends on local supply and demand, the proximity of recycling mills and foundries, and seasonal construction activity.

Brass scrap quality plays a significant role in pricing. Clean, sorted Brass scrap free of contaminants such as plastic, rubber, or mixed metals typically commands 10-15% higher rates than unsorted or mixed-grade material. If you're selling Brass scrap in Murliganj, taking the time to separate and clean your material can significantly improve the price you receive. Industrial sellers with consistent bulk volumes often negotiate premium rates with dealers, while household sellers benefit from comparing quotes across multiple verified buyers listed on ScrapRates.in.

Logistics costs also impact the final price — dealers who offer doorstep pickup may factor in transportation expenses, especially for smaller quantities. How to identify real brass from brass-plated items?

Use a magnet — real brass is non-magnetic. Brass-plated steel will stick to the magnet and is only worth steel scrap prices. Scratch the surface — brass shows a consistent golden color underneath, while plated items reveal grey steel. Real brass is also heavier than it looks.

What household items contain brass?

Door knobs, hinges, faucets, old keys, zipper pulls, lamp fittings, puja items (bells, lamps, idols), old taps and valves, curtain rods, and decorative hardware. In Indian households, old brass utensils and puja items are common sources worth checking.
